Laird v. American Honda Finance Corp et al

Filing 18

ORDER. IT IS HEREBY ORDERED that 17 the joint motion is GRANTED, and all claims against American Honda Finance Corp. are DISMISSED with prejudice, each party to bear its own fees and costs. Signed by Judge Jennifer A. Dorsey on 8/31/17. (Copies have been distributed pursuant to the NEF - ADR)
